Let x be the number of cases of paper towels and y be the number of cases of soap. The system of linear equation that would best represent the given is,
x + y = 10
12x + 15y = 129
The values of x and y are 7 and 3.
Sarah both 7 cases of paper towel.
It is not possible for Sarah to buy exactly 20 bottles because first of all the cases contains only 12 bottles and 20 is not divisible by 12.

4 gal 2 pt
Step-by-step explanation:
8 pt = 1 gal
7 gal 1 pt = 57 pt
2 gal 7 pt = 23 pt
57 pt - 23 pt = 34 pt
34 pt = 4 gal 2 pt
